OK I went to CJ Strike on Memorial Day weekend, as my son had the Middle School State Track Meet in Meridian. We decided to spend a couple of days at CJ Strike when I got there I was shocked to find it ice free, but my son had packed these rather strange large fishing poles with us, so we thought we would give it a try. (If you know me you are aware that I almost exclusively ice fish[
] Wow what a great 24 hours we absolutely did well for perch and bluegill at Cottonwood. My wife and daughter were also catching quite a few fish. We decided to go for bass and went over near Cove and had an amazing couple of hours catching and releasing nearly 50 bass. Fished that night managing a few fish, but around 11:00 PM my son got a nice channel cat. The next morning we returned to Cottonwood and we did better for Crappie; I did manage one nice medium plate size one with a bunch of 5-6''. In all we caught five species of fish with a grand total of 268 fish, all caught and released!
